Transaction 64b532aff66115c5537efdb8a015b4aef4990ee5907de28cb56c27c2b8601386

1 Input
2 Outputs
  • 64b532aff66115c5537efdb8a015b4aef4990ee5907de28cb56c27c2b8601386:0
  • value  162649200
    address  bc1qc2rcvdxzzt05aafhyyz3n95re5nzq0g08yy08p
  • 64b532aff66115c5537efdb8a015b4aef4990ee5907de28cb56c27c2b8601386:1
  • value  140000000
    address  3QTUMcLfgti7eWVBEjExt99yC1NvXfkDNH